Wednesday's Cable Ratings: "Moonshiners" Tops Demos for Fifth Straight Week
By The Futon Critic Staff (TFC)

select cable nielsen ratings
(national numbers for wednesday, february 6, 2013)

Here are the highlights of 25 ad-sustained programs that aired in primetime on the cable networks last night, courtesy of TravisYanan:

Moonshiners (10:00) - Discovery
2.493 million viewers, #1; 1.405 million adults 18-49 (1.1 rating), #1

The Americans - FX
1.966 million viewers, #2; 1.072 million adults 18-49 (0.8 rating), #3

Necessary Roughness - USA
1.856 million viewers, #3; 0.630 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#7

Top Chef: Seattle (10:00) - Bravo
1.645 million viewers, #4; 0.927 million adults 18-49 (0.7 rating), #5

Barter Kings (10:00, 60 Minutes) - A&E
1.632 million viewers, #5; 0.960 million adults 18-49 (0.8 rating), #4

Workaholics - Comedy Central
1.599 million viewers, #6; 1.241 million adults 18-49 (1.0 rating), #2

Full Throttle Saloon - truTV
1.548 million viewers, #7; 0.859 million adults 18-49 (0.7 rating), #6

Dragons: Riders of Berk (8:00) - Cartoon
1.453 million viewers, #8; 0.372 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#19

Ghost Hunters - Syfy
1.294 million viewers, #9; 0.567 million adults 18-49 (0.4 rating), #10

Hot in Cleveland - TV Land
1.288 million viewers, #10; 0.404 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#16

Ghost Mine - Syfy
1.100 million viewers, #11; 0.543 million adults 18-49 (0.4 rating), #12

NBA Basketball: Spurs at Timberwolves - ESPN
1.092 million viewers, #12; 0.606 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#8

Happily Divorced - TV Land
1.064 million viewers, #13; 0.360 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#20

Auction Hunters (9:00) - Spike TV
1.058 million viewers, #14; 0.439 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#14

Toddlers & Tiaras (9:00) - TLC
0.894 million viewers, #15; 0.388 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#17

Bobby's Dinner Battle (10:00) - Food
0.846 million viewers, #16; 0.423 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#15

Kroll Show - Comedy Central
0.824 million viewers, #17; 0.565 million adults 18-49 (0.4 rating), #11

Washington Heights (10:00) - MTV
0.778 million viewers, #18; 0.571 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#9

Cheer Perfection - TLC
0.772 million viewers, #19; 0.378 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#18

Savage Family Diggers (10:00) - Spike TV
0.759 million viewers, #20; 0.298 million adults 18-49 (0.2 rating), #21

The Soup - E!
0.742 million viewers, #21; 0.514 million adults 18-49 (0.4 rating), #13

Love You, Mean It with Whitney Cummings - E!
0.396 million viewers, #22; 0.216 million adults 18-49 (0.2 rating), #22

Making Mr. Right (10:00) - VH1
0.214 million viewers, #23; 0.150 million adults 18-49 (0.1 rating), #23

Inside the NFL - Showtime
0.119 million viewers, #24; 0.031 million adults 18-49 (0.0 rating), #25

60 Minutes Sports - Showtime
0.114 million viewers, #25; 0.050 million adults 18-49 (0.0 rating), #24

Source: Nielsen Media Research
